2025 Grammy Nominations and Award Ceremony Acknowledge Top Artists
Familiar talents continue to shine with a few new faces hitting the scene resulting in mixed reviews
By: Michael Russo
The nominations for the 2025 Grammy Awards were released on November 7, 2024. Following a highly decorated year for the Music Industry filled to the brim with notable releases, many artists are experiencing their banner year at the Grammys, making this one of the most exciting years for the awards show ever.
Notably, Beyonce received a whopping 11 Grammy nominations for her album Cowboy Carter. The album, which marked a stark change in sound for the R&B artist to country, was a massive critical and commercial success. These nominations include Best Country Song, Record of the Year, and Song of the Year for her #1 hit “Texas Hold ‘Em, as well as Best Country Album and Album of the Year. This increases her overall nomination count to a record-shattering 99 nominations.
Chappell Roan and Sabrina Carpenter both received six Grammy nominations in their breakout year, with both artists getting nominations for Album, Record, and Song of the Year as well as Best New Artist. Chappell Roan experienced a meteoric rise in popularity this year following the release of her gigantic hit “Good Luck Babe!” and the rise of previous songs such as “HOT TO GO!” and “Pink Pony Club.” Meanwhile, Sabrina Carpenter, who was already starting to gain momentum off of the success of hits like “Feather,” exploded into the mainstream with the two mega-hit songs “Espresso” and “Please Please Please,” which absolutely dominated streaming services and pop radio over the summer. Another artist who had a banner year was Charli XCX, who earned seven nominations off the success of her album Brat, which spawned hits such as “360,” “Apple,” and “Guess featuring Billie Eilish,”all of which earned nominations.
Billie Eilish also had a massive year following the success of her album Hit Me Hard and Soft; she received seven Grammy nominations including Record and Song of the Year for her massive hit “BIRDS OF A FEATHER.” Taylor Swift also had a solid showing, earning six Grammy nominations for her album The Tortured Poets Department, which was the best selling album of the year and spawned global hits “Fortnight” and “I Can Do It With A Broken Heart.”
Following one of the most eventful years for hip hop music in recent time, the Grammy nominations in the Rap categories have become as significant as ever. Typically, hip hop does not receive as much recognition compared to other genres, but this year, many hip hop artists had a very strong showing at the Grammys. Doechii in particular had a great breakout year, earning 4 Grammy nominations including Best Rap Album for her mixtape Alligator Bites Never Heal. Other artists who received nods include Eminem and GloRilla, the latter of whom also experienced a wildly successful year off of her song “Yeah Glo!” Biggest of all was Kendrick Lamar, who garnered seven Grammy nominations in one of his best years ever commercially. Five out of the seven nominations were for his global #1 hit “Not Like Us,” one of Lamar’s biggest songs ever and a diss track towards fellow rap artist Drake.
The Grammys this year are as competitive as ever and will take place on February 10, 2025.
UPDATE: Grammy Results...and the award goes to~~~
Beyoncé had the most nominations with eleven and further etched her name in history by winning both Album of the Year and Best Country Album for “Cowboy Carter.” This victory makes her the first Black artist to win Best Country Album and the first Black woman to win Album of the Year since Lauryn Hill in 1999.
Kendrick Lamar’s “Not Like Us” was the other headliner for the night as he won five awards including Record of the Year and Song of the Year. With this achievement, Lamar became the second rap artist to win both awards after Childish Gambino in 2019.
Chappell Roan took home the award for Best New Artist, while Sierra Ferrell dominated the American roots categories, winning all four awards she was nominated for.
Doechii's “Alligator Bites Never Heal” earned her the award for Best Rap Album, thus becoming the third woman to earn this accolade after Lauryn Hill in 1997 and Cardi B in 2019. Despite having bronchitis and the flu, Doechii performed “Catfish” and “Denial is a River” live and squashed many lip sync rumors.

On November 12th, the Strong National Museum of Play announced their 2024 new inductees to the Toy Hall of Fame. Three new toys were selected to join a growing list of the nation's favorite games, gadgets, and collectables. They were… My Little Pony dolls, the Phase 10 card game, and Transformers action figures.
The Museum of Play has been cultivating their list since 1998. This year's toys will join the beloved list of items. Fan favorites include the teddy bear, Crayola crayons, Barbie, and Slime.
Anyone can nominate their favorite toy to be inducted. However, the ultimate decision is made with the advice of historians, educators, and other devoted individuals. The list of toys serves to memorialize toys that have sustained popularity and fostered creative play over a long period of time. They are judged based on four criteria: Icon Status, Longevity, Discovery, and Innovation.
My Little Pony
First released in the 1980s, My Little Pony is a line of miniature horse dolls that quickly rose to fame. The plastic horses come in over a thousand different colors and designs. They became beloved by children for their realistic designs and endless storytelling and fantasy opportunities. Now, My Little Pony even has their own TV show and endless other merchandise.
Phase 10
Phase 10 is a popular card game that combines elements of rummy and strategy, where players aim to complete ten specific phases in a set order. Each phase consists of different card combinations, such as sets or runs, and players must collect and lay down the right cards to progress. The game is played over multiple rounds, and the first player to complete all ten phases wins. Since its creation in the 1980s, Phase 10 has become a beloved family game. Today, over 4 million decks are sold each year, and the game is played in over 60 countries.
Transformers
Transformers is a popular toy and media franchise released in 1984. It features detailed action figures that can transform their shapes into vehicles. The Transformers come with an elaborate backstory, solidified with comic books and a Marvel Television show. The franchise includes not only TV shows and movies, but electronic games, clothes, and even its own cereal. Transformer characters like Optimus Prime and Megatron are famous worldwide.

America Loses Creative Inventor: "Unpacking" the life of Murray McCory
Where would we be without his ingenius invention of the backpack?
By: Olivia Coish
On October 7th, 2024 in Seattle, Murray McCory, the founder of the outdoor equipment company, JanSport, died at age 80. McCory’s signature invention of the lightweight backpack revolutionized school life for millions of students. His daughter, Heidi Van Brost, disclosed that his death was caused by complications of congestive heart failure, and that he passed in the hospital surrounded by his loved ones.
JanSport backpacks trace back to the 1960’s and 70’s when counterculture and creativity were on the rise. McCory was a student at the University of Washington when he entered a national competition to design a new product using just aluminum. The event was sponsored by Alcoa, the maker of the metal. Going into the competition, McCory already had initial complaints about the stiff, one size-fits-all wooden frames of traditional hiking backpacks. To rectify the problem, McCory developed a new frame using adjustable and lightweight aluminum. He also included a nylon pack with a water bottle pocket that helped McCory take first place.
Following the competition, McCory along with his girlfriend, Jan Lewis, decided to bring his creation to the market. The couple worked together by honing their skills. While McCory dealt with the designs and metal fabrication, Lewis planned patterns and was responsible for the sewing. For the first several years, the couple operated their business out of a spare room above an auto shop. To save money, they lived with Lewis’ parents and slept on foldaway cots in the JanSport workshop. McCory and Lewis dedicated most of their time to perfecting their invention. More often than not, the couple was seen taking camping trips to test their prototype.
In 1967, they founded the company, JanSport, which is named in honor of McCory’s girlfriend. The couple married two years later. As their market grew, McCory decided to expand the business by making snowshoes, a frame backpacks for dogs, and mummy-style sleeping bags. McCory was frustrated with bulky A-frame tents, so he embarked on creating a dome shaped frame that was both lightweight and strong enough to withstand winds. It was not long until dome tents were sold everywhere. With help from his cousin, Skip Yowell, who handle sales and marketing, JanSport was making more than one million dollars a year in revenue by the mid 1970’s. This is equivalent to about 6 million dollars in today's currency.
McCory’s backpack became increasingly popular at the University of Washington’s campus bookstore, and soon reached the markets of colleges all around the country. By the mid 1980’s, JanSport bags were being used in high schools, which encouraged other companies, such as L.L Bean, to partner with McCory. He spent decades designing equipment for various outdoor companies, and eventually sold the business in 1972 to K2 Corporation, a ski making company. JanSport is now owned by VF Corporation, which also owns North Face and other outdoor brands. As for McCory, the inventor returned to the outdoors in 1990 by moving to eastern Washington where he worked on recycling programs and oversaw a Rails-to-Trails project. His legacy is survived by his son, stepson, and five grandchildren.

Take a Look at The History of "Black Friday"and How the Term Originated
Term has evolved: now describes hoards of bargain-hunting consumers flooding the stores
By: Matthew Campbell
Before "Black Friday" was a catchy phrase for sale prices and busy retail spaces, it was a founded concept of financial doom and disaster, only transforming into modern-day consumerism.
The first mention of "Black Friday" in print occurred in an American newspaper on September 24, 1869, and linked the day of "Black Friday" with financial ruin in America like no other. On this day, two of America's most notorious financiers—Jay Gould and James Fisk—tried to corner the gold market to their benefit. Ultimately, it backfired—like a marble rolling down the steepest side of a hill—and when they lost the advantage, the market crashed. Also, like a marble rolling out of control when it starts rolling, the financial market crashed, too, with upheaval at every turn. The intentions of "Black Friday" were to commemorate the day of confusion and the subsequent fallout from the stock market crash that left millions of Americans financially devastated. Yet it was in the mid-1900s that "Black Friday" became associated with the day after Thanksgiving.
In the 1950s, for example, police in Philadelphia referred to the mania that unfolded when suburbanites and tourists entered the city for the Saturday Army-Navy football game. Throngs of people in a stunned and excited frenzy created traffic jams, required police to work overtime without pay, and generated overall pandemonium. Yet, as the traders within the city started to acknowledge that the influx from the suburbs generated disposable income with which to spend, they created in-town pop-up sales opportunities. However, "Black Friday" was still associated with negativity.
In the 1980s, retailers nationwide tried to hijack the term and manufacture a new promotional campaign. "Black Friday" became synonymous with the positive—"being in the black" transformed due to the overwhelming numbers of holiday shoppers and businesses making more profits, and "Black Friday" was a commemoration of that additional revenue. The ploy succeeded—massive sales were promoted to ensure it became further entrenched as the unofficial start of the holiday shopping season. Black Friday is a global shopping phenomenon.
The most extensive shopping day in the United States occurs on Black Friday. Even e-commerce merchants have "Black Friday" events as e-commerce grows—some associated with "Cyber Monday" or days after that continue the festivities. Other nations have gotten in on the action, adding their spelling versions to embrace their holiday shopping season jumpstart. Yet remnants of the madness of Black Friday exist too, with stores overflowing, people standing in checkout lines winding up and down aisles, and even fistfights. For many, this was all part of the equation, the desired effort for holiday shopping, but this was not to be confused with the shopping day that kicked off economic despair.
Taylor Swift Concludes Highly Successful Record-Breaking Eras Tour
Fans throughout the world enjoyed the musical phenomenon while events boosted local economies
By: Katharine Grudburg
On December 8th, 2024, Taylor Swift ended her worldwide stadium tour. After 149 shows, 51 cities, and 5 continents, Swift grossed $2 Billion. After over a 3 year gap between her “Eras Tour” and “Reputation Tour,” the concerts were a long-awaited celebration among fans. Within minutes of their release in November of 2022, tickets for the extravaganza sold out.
The tour opened on March 17th, 2023 in Glendale, Arizona. Consisting of 44 songs from 10 different albums, the show was about 3.5 hours long. Each set of the show featured a different “era” of Swift’s career. Her outfits corresponded to each albums’ respective color scheme, ranging anywhere from bright pastels to dull neutrals. The stadium lit up with vibrant colors illuminating from the fans’ glowing bracelets. Fans from home tuned in to the excitement via livestream. This excitement continued almost every Friday, Saturday, and Sunday night for 21 months straight. She visited the U.S. primarily, but also took stops in Latin America, Asia-Pacific, Europe, Canada, and Australia.
The tour closed in Vancouver, Canada. With the release of her album “The Tortured Poets Department” in April of 2024, her set now featured 11 different eras. She closed off the tour with her song “Long Live,” giving fans a bittersweet sentiment that this tour would be remembered. Swift also posted to her Instagram 3 days after the tour with the caption, “It was rare” -- a lyric from her song, “All Too Well,” that reflects on remembering the past.
The Eras Tour was not just a successful concert for Swift -- it was a life changing experience for thousands of fans. Swift’s tour stood out from the basic concert. Since the beginning of the tour, fans started a friendship bracelet project. In this, concert attendees would bring in handmade bracelets, usually relating to a specific song or album, and trade them with other people there. It quickly became a haven for fans to interact and become friends with people who loved the same artist as much as they did. This was not the only way fans had a part in the concert, however. They often took it into their own hands to add to the concert, such as shouting a certain chant in between lyrics or holding up their phone flashlights during a song written about Swift’s deceased grandmother. Fans even had the chance to interact with the pop star at every concert, one of Swift’s crew members would pick a lucky contestant to receive her black fedora during her performance of “22.” Both Swift and fans both took steps to make the concert special and unique.

How Do We Explain the Sudden Rise in Popularity of Crumbl Cookies?
Is the flavor worth the 800 calories per cookie?
By: Zayna Saidi
With over a million cookies being sold daily, Crumbl Cookies, the gourmet dessert franchise, is quickly becoming one of the most popular and successful upcoming businesses in recent years.
The Crumbl company started with two cousins, Jason McGowan and Sawyer Hemsley, who strived to create what they deemed the perfect version of the signature chocolate chip cookie. Opening their first location in Logan, Utah, the cousins began sharing their version of the classic cookie with the public. Now, as their business rapidly expands, with over 1,000 national and international locations founded in less than a decade, people have grown to wonder how Crumbl has gained so much popularity in such a short amount of time.
The main factor to Crumbl’s success is their business model. Each week, the company presents their dessert lineup, usually introducing at least one new dessert flavor. Additionally, on weeks with national holidays, they sell cookies matching the theme of the occasion. With the exception of the chocolate chip cookies, which are always included in the weekly rotations, many flavors are not again seen for several weeks, and sometimes even for months. This clever design of a rotating menu results in customers feeling more obligation in returning weekly to try the new flavors and purchase their favorites before they are removed from the menu.
Also, the owners are dedicated to making sure that they consider each of their recipes to be perfect before selling them. Overall, Crumbl dedicates thousands of dollars to the production of each new flavor, involving the creation, reviewing, and re-working of each dessert prior to sending them into the weekly rotations.
This is not the only reason for the company’s sudden uprising. Crumbl’s brand is simple yet easily recognizable, with their pink box packaging allowing them to quickly become well known throughout the world. Furthermore, their use of social media has helped them reach a wider audience, as they now have millions of followers across a variety of platforms such as TikTok, Instagram, Facebook, and more.
However, it has not only been a success for the business. Despite their efforts at perfecting each recipe, thousands of consumers have criticized their desserts for being too sweet, underbaked, lacking in flavor, and more. This, in addition to their prices, with a box of just four cookies averaging to $18, many believe that Crumbl is far overrated.
Despite the overwhelming amount of criticism they have received, hundreds of influencers upload weekly “unboxing” videos where they review each flavor. Although not all flavors are adored by consumers, the range of flavors that the company has produced over the years has resulted in at least one dessert that will bring a customer back for more.
Overall, the strategic marketing of the company has led them to major success despite the controversy surrounding if they are deserving of such fame. Although many may disagree with their popularity, the company still earns roughly 1.7 million dollars in annual sales, with the number only continuing to grow with each passing year.
